Allometric equations for yield predictions of enset (Ensete ventricosum) and khat (Catha edulis) grown in home gardens of southern Ethiopia

The objective of this study was to develop linear allometric models for estimating the edible (food and feed) and commercial yields of enset and khat plants, respectively. Data were collected from 20 enset and 100 khat plants. Diameter at 50‐cm height (d50), pseudostem height (hp) and their combination were good predictor variables for the food products of enset with adjusted R2 values above 0.85, while d50, hp, edible pseudostem height (hep), total height (ht) and their combination were good predictor variables for the feed products of enset with adjusted R2 values above 0.70. For dwarf khat plants crown area (ca) combined with total height (ht) resulted in the best prediction with an adjusted R2 of 0.77, while the leaf and twig dry weight for tall khat plants was best predicted by ca with adjusted R2 of 0.43. In all cases linear models were used.
